This week marks a wonderful occasion for Madison film fans - the return of UW Cinematheque and WUD Film, whose screenings are free and open to the public in high-quality theaters right in the middle of downtown. I used to be a member of WUD Film almost a decade ago now, and I really think the university’s film programming is a jewel unlike any I’ve heard of in any other city.
In new releases, obviously The Brutalist has received a lot of attention (and a little controversy) already, so I want to highlight other new films. Mike Leigh’s Hard Truths, his reunion with Secrets & Lies star Marianne Jean-Baptiste, has been added to AMC’s schedule this week, and the master director of Naked, Topsy-Turvy, and Happy-Go-Lucky represents the absolute greatest in English cinema. Another master, Ocean’s Eleven and Erin Brockovich director Steven Soderbergh, returns to theaters with his first ever horror film, Presence, a haunted house story told from the perspective of the ghost.
By comparison, Naoko Yamada, anime director of series K-On! and films A Silent Voice and Liz & The Blue Bird, is a relative newcomer, but her film The Colors Within has been raved as one of the best animated films of the year. Lastly, I want to make a note of the return of the MMOCA Cinema series on 1/29, starting with Brazilian documentary The Falling Sky and continuing on 2/5 with Hong Sang Soo’s A Traveler’s Needs. These are films that will likely not play anywhere else in Madison, and may even miss traditional streaming platforms entirely, so see them while you can!
In repertory, UW Cinematheque is getting the ball rolling with Tarsem Singh’s fantastical 2006 Lee Pace film The Fall, renowned for its gorgeous imagery created in conjunction with Mishima: A Life in Four Chapters and Bram Stoker’s Dracula artist Eiko Ishioka. They continue on Saturday with Paul Newman hockey comedy Slap Shot, a widely regarded “guy movie” cult classic also starring a young Michael Ontkean (Sheriff Truman in Twin Peaks) and legendary character actor M. Emmet Walsh. Shortly after Slap Shot wraps up, WUD Film will be exhibiting Jim Henson cult classic The Dark Crystal, a film maybe best known for scarring Muppet-loving youngsters with its wild creature effects. Sunday, you can find Cinematheque at the Chazen Museum of Art, showing Robert Bresson classic Pickpocket, widely considered one of the best films of all time and a fairly accessible crime procedural for those otherwise scared of international cinema.
The next week, Cinematheque has another full program with renowned international film All We Imagine As Light, French thriller classic The Wages of Fear, and
Czech dark comedy Murdering the Devil. But of special note that week is the heavy programming at the Bartell Theater right near the Capitol - though they play films infrequently, they’ll be showing John Belushi classic Animal House, John Waters’ infamous and “disgusting” Pink Flamingos, Marvel luminary Black Panther, and Steven Spielberg sci-fi epic Close Encounters of the Third Kind from Thursday to Saturday. It’s a busy week with too many great choices, so start making your plans early!
Lastly, looking far ahead at that second weekend of February, we’ll see (among other screenings) the Madison debuts of gonzo action comedy Love Hurts, silly slasher Heart Eyes, Brazil’s critical darling I’m Still Here, Midwest crime fiasco thriller Dead Mail at UW Cinematheque, and a killer double-header of Sorcerer and Seven Samurai at 4070 Vilas.
